This company is looking for a Frontend Web Developer to assist the Application Delivery Manager in designing, developing, and maintaining internal and customer business applications and systems.

Key Position Responsibilities:

- Assisting with analysis, problem-solving, development and delivery of maintainable and efficient software solution elements across their business capabilities.
- Develop software which meets or exceeds their quality and performance standards.
- Function collaboratively as a member of a professional technology team engaged in the structured and timely delivery of technology solutions.
- Pursue self-improvement, innovation and the adoption of best practice in order to enhance the productivity and effectiveness of the team.
- Develop and execute test plans that thoroughly test applications and allow for quality implementation of applications;
o Prepare and maintain documentation of applications and systems.
o Communicate status, issues and risks with leaders in a timely manner.
o Deliver outcomes that fit within the design direction and architectural boundaries provided by the design team.
- Provide consistent and improving level of quality within the code base, working with the Quality Assurance team to allow an efficient, high quality test capability.
- Provide delivery outcomes that minimise impact on operations while maintaining second-level support, delivering increased stability to their enterprise applications.

Required Knowledge, Skills and Abilities:

- Good knowledge of HTML, CSS, JavaScript and general web development principles.
- Experience consuming RESTful interfaces.
- Experience with Single Page Websites and responsive web design.
- Ability to work independently and/or in a team.
- Demonstrated experience creating work item estimates.
- Ability to independently manage time, working towards and meeting agreed deadlines
